Output 66d5906214d85811fa52bf115fa5cde1b4b866bb738ed02811d771e0247ea561:1

value
8606248
script pubkey
OP_0 OP_PUSHBYTES_20 c19aa308ab58b41f4bac954658c107832011438c
address
ltc1qcxd2xz9ttz6p7javj4r93sg8svspzsuv2su73g
transaction
66d5906214d85811fa52bf115fa5cde1b4b866bb738ed02811d771e0247ea561
spent
true